>I know people who have had to have their ileostomy moved from the right
>side to the left because of hernias etc, but haven't heard of the other
>way round, doesn't mean it can't necessarily be done though, I think
>the best person to speak to would be your surgeon.
>
I agree about speaking with the surgeon, but it is always better to have
a few details to hand before doing so.
The small intestine is four times the length of the colon, and seems to
cross the abdomen conveniently, so I suppose there is a lot more scope
to switch over an ileostomy by shortening the small intestine a few
inches.
